MCMS closes season with budding modern classical duo
Delivering the last in its 2024-25 performance series, Montana Chamber Music Society will present Elena Urioste and Tom Poster on Saturday, April 12th. The concert will be held at Reynolds Recital Hall on the Montana State University campus. Music begins at 7:30pm.

BFS screenings include crime comedy, canoeing adventure
Bozeman Film Society continues its latest season with crime comedy Riff Raff on Wednesday, April 9th. The event will be held at Downtown Bozeman's Ellen Theatre at 7pm.
